WWE NXT Champion Bron Breakker gave a reference to his uncle Scott’s most infamous promo on this week’s episode of NXT.
In the run-up to TNA Wrestling’s Sacrifice 2008 pay-per-view event, Scott Steiner explained with some unique mathematics why he was guaranteed to win a triple threat against Kurt Angle and Samoa Joe.
Initially claiming that a triple-threat gives each participant a 33 1/3 percent chance of winning, Steiner claimed that he had a 141 2/3 chance of victory in the match Joe won.
On WWE NXT, Breakker spoke about his own upcoming triple threat match, saying his opponents have a 33 1/3 percent chance of winning.
The fans live at WWE NXT reacted loudly, fully aware of the reference, which was later shared by WWE on Twitter.

Breakker will defend the NXT Championship against JD McDonagh and Ilja Dragunov at Halloween Havoc.
